Main duties of the job

The post holder will provide a dental hygiene/therapy service at Bristol Dental Hospital for patients with cleft lip and/or palate, and similar conditions, who are under the care of the Consultant Cleft Orthodontist, Consultant Cleft and Maxillofacial Surgeons, Consultants in Paediatric and Restorative Dentistry and the Special Care service.

The priority patient group for this post is children and adults born with cleft lip and/or palate, under the care of the South West Cleft Service. The post holder will provide clinical care and preventative treatment to this patient group. A proportion of this cohort have complex needs and patients with high levels of anxiety and challenging behaviour also require dental care.

The work will cover the full range of treatments currently permitted under the General Dental Council Regulations, including all extended duties for Dental Hygienists and Dental Therapists, provided that specific clinical duties are only undertaken if trained and competent to do so.

The post holder will take responsibility for implementing the hospital's oral health policy, and may propose changes to practices/procedures, within the South West Cleft Service in the Bristol Dental Hospital.

Person Specification
Knowledge and Experience
  • Experience of working with children and adults with complex needs
  • Knowledge of safeguarding issues
  • Working within a team (and ability to self-direct their workload)
Skills and Abilities
  • Highly specialist manual dexterity, with the skills to provide the full range of treatments currently permitted under the General Dental Council's Scope of Practice including all extended duties for dental hygienists
  • Competence to develop oral healthcare services for designated groups of patients across the trust
  • Communication and empathetic skills with patients at a level more advanced than those required for routine care in a general setting
  • Ability to work positively and professionally with a variety of staff eg. surgeons, orthodontists, dental nurses, technicians and administrative staff
  • Sufficient computer and keyboard skills
  • General knowledge of the patient's journey from birth to 20 years across all disciplines for patients born with an orofacial cleft
  • Knowledge of the dental and oral health issues relating to patients born with orofacial clefting
  • Knowledge of the care of patients undergoing treatment for cancer of the head and neck and special care dentistry
Qualifications and Training
  • Degree / Diploma in Dental Hygiene and/or Dental Therapy plus demonstrative experience of working with children and adults with complex needs
  • Professional portfolio of continuing professional development
